About this vintage design furniture

Brutalist planter named Vasque was designed by Willy Guhl in the 1960s. Made entirely of concrete. This large "bowl" can be placed on its base either at an angle or straight. The planter has no damage, but rich patina. A classic by Willy Guhl. The dimensions are: 40 cm high - 80 cm diameter Reference : 261905

About the designer

Willy GUHL

Willy Guhl is a pioneer of Swiss industrial design. He is one of the leading exponents of neo-functionalism.
